When upgrading your kitchen, kitchen lighting tends to be neglected, yet it plays a crucial role in both functionality and ambiance. Selecting energy-efficient lighting fixtures not only cuts down on energy expenses but also supports environmentally responsible living. With a variety of options available today, making the right choice can seem overwhelming. However, focusing on a few key factors can help you find the perfect balance between efficiency, brightness, and style.


Start by considering the kind of bulb technology. LEDs represent the top tier in energy efficiency today. They use up to 75% less energy than traditional incandescent bulbs and last many times longer, with lifespans reaching 25,000+ hours. While the initial investment might be greater, the durable performance pays off over time. CFLs offer a secondary energy-efficient option, though they have mercury content requiring careful disposal and are being phased out in favor of LEDs.


Next, pay attention to brightness levels and light hue. Lumen count indicates how bright a bulb is, unlike watts. A higher lumen count means a brighter light. For kitchen tasks like food prep and stove work, PARTIZANI aim for fixtures that provide at least a combined output of 3000–4000 lumens. The Kelvin rating determines the warmth or coolness of the light. For kitchens, a range between 3000K and 4000K is ideal offering a soft white to balanced daylight tone that improves clarity without glare.


The placement and type of fixtures are also important. Downlights offer consistent brightness with a minimalist design, while lighting beneath cabinets brightens work surfaces. Pendant lights over islands or sinks can combine style with function, especially when fitted with LED or ENERGY STAR-rated lamps. Dimming controls allow customization and conserve power by allowing you to adjust brightness based on your needs.


Lastly, look for lighting fixtures with ENERGY STAR certification. These products follow government-mandated efficiency requirements and are tested for performance and longevity. Choosing certified fixtures ensures you’re getting a product that delivers on both quality and savings.


By thoughtfully selecting energy-efficient lighting, you can create a kitchen that is both practical and environmentally responsible. With the right combination of energy-saving bulbs, adequate lumen output, and strategic layout, your kitchen will be bright, efficient, and economical over time.
